Understanding Game Mechanics and Probability
A fundamental aspect of transitioning from beginner’s luck to expert play is a comprehensive understanding of game mechanics. This goes beyond simply knowing the rules; it involves grasping the underlying principles that govern a game’s outcome. For instance, in slot games, understanding the Return to Player (RTP) percentage and volatility is crucial. RTP indicates the theoretical percentage of wagered money that is returned to players over time, while volatility describes the risk associated with playing a particular slot. High volatility slots offer larger potential payouts but occur less frequently, while low volatility slots provide more frequent, smaller wins. Knowing these factors allows players to select games that align with their risk tolerance and playing style.
Probability plays a central role in nearly all casino games. Understanding basic probability concepts, such as the odds of drawing a specific card in poker or rolling a particular number in craps, can give players a significant advantage. It's important to realize however, that while understanding probability can improve your decision-making, many casino games still incorporate a house edge, meaning the casino always has a statistical advantage over the long run. Skilled players aim to minimize this disadvantage through informed betting and strategic gameplay.
| Game Type | Typical House Edge |
|---|---|
| Slots | 2% – 15% |
| Blackjack (Optimal Strategy) | 0.5% – 1% |
| Roulette (European) | 2.7% |
| Baccarat | 1.06% (Banker Bet) |
The table above illustrates the varying house edges across different popular casino games. As you can see, Blackjack, when played with optimal strategy, offers one of the lowest house edges. This demonstrates the impact that player skill and decision-making can have on the outcome. Learning and implementing optimal strategies, specific to each game, is a key step in elevating one’s gameplay.

Furthermore, understanding the different types of bets available and their associated odds is essential. For example, in roulette, a straight-up bet on a single number offers a high payout but has a low probability of winning, while a bet on red or black offers a lower payout but has a higher probability of success. Choosing the right bet depends on your risk tolerance and desired payout.

The Importance of Mental Discipline and Emotional Control
While strategic knowledge and skilled gameplay are crucial, the often-overlooked aspect of mental discipline and emotional control plays a vital role in long-term success. Gambling can be emotionally charged, particularly during losing streaks. It’s easy to fall into the trap of chasing losses, making impulsive decisions, or letting emotions cloud judgment. Maintaining composure and sticking to your pre-defined strategy, even in the face of adversity, is paramount.
Tilt, a term commonly used in poker, describes a state of emotional frustration or confusion that leads to poor decision-making. Learning to recognize the signs of tilt and taking a break when you feel yourself becoming emotionally compromised is essential. Practicing mindfulness techniques, such as deep breathing or meditation, can help maintain focus and emotional regulation. A calm and rational mindset is far more conducive to making sound judgments than an impulsive and emotional one.
